ERDAS IMAGINE 11.0.5 Software Now Available

Intergraph is proud to announce a new minor release of ERDAS IMAGINE, now available to all customers with ERDAS 2011 software. Users can download ERDAS IMAGINE 11.0.5 from the product webpage. This release includes changes from all previous service packs released for ERDAS IMAGINE 2011.

ERDAS IMAGINE is a leading geospatial data authoring system, incorporating geospatial image processing and analysis and remote sensing into a single powerful, convenient package. ERDAS IMAGINE enables users to easily create value-added products such as 2D and 3D images, 3D flythrough movies and cartographic-quality map compositions from geospatial data. Intergraph has paired GeoMedia® and ERDAS IMAGINE to deliver a comprehensive suite of image processing coupled with GIS analysis and data management capabilities. GeoMedia is a powerful GIS data management and analysis package that enables users to realize the maximum value of their geospatial resources.

Enhancements since the release of ERDAS IMAGINE 2011 include more Live Link connections between ERDAS IMAGINE and GeoMedia, providing truly connected image processing and GIS products. Brought together by a single organization, users can easily leverage these two products in unison to construct a larger, clearer geospatial picture. Specifically, the Live Link changes enable users to:

- Connect the GeoMedia Map Window and ERDAS IMAGINE Viewer
- Natively read GeoMedia Warehouse files in ERDAS IMAGINE
- Write to GeoMedia Warehouse Attributes in the ERDAS IMAGINE spatial modeler
- Export GeoMedia Warehouses to shapefiles
- Import shapefiles to GeoMedia Warehouses

Users can also take advantage of other enhancements, including the cloud remover in MosaicPro, a tool for creating seamless image mosaics. Users can now quickly and easily remove clouds from their image mosaics by digitizing cloud areas and manually adjusting the radiometry of individual images. MosaicPro now also allows users to use batch and distributed processing when outputting image tiles. In addition, this release provides support for new sensor models, including the VisionMap A3 aerial sensor and the Pleiades satellite constellation. ERDAS IMAGINE's classification capabilities are also strengthened in this release by offering new options for supervised classification, spectral angle mapping and spectral correlation mapping.

ERDAS APOLLO Manages Space Data

ERDAS announces that the Italian Space Agency (ASI) is using ERDAS APOLLO to manage data collected from different space missions and deliver it for public consumption via a web portal.

ASI is collaborating with the ESA and the National Aeronautics and Space Administration (NASA) on the Cassini-Huygens, Mars Express, and Mars Reconnaissance Orbiter (MRO) missions. The Cassini-Huygens mission primarily focuses on two of Saturn’s moons, Titan and Enceladus, as well as Saturn itself. So far, the mission has found evidence of heat and organic chemicals and the possibility of liquid water on the surface of Enceladus, indicating the potential for the formation of primitive life forms. Cassini, the orbiter component of Cassini-Huygens, carries 12 instruments which have returned a daily stream of data since arriving at Saturn in 2004. Huygens, the smaller probe portion of Cassini-Huygens, landed on Titan’s surface in 2005 and returns data about Titan’s vast methane lakes and hydrocarbon sand dunes.

The primary objective of the Mars Express mission is to investigate the basic characteristics of Mars. The Mars Express orbiter will create high-resolution imagery (10 meters/pixel) of the entire Martian surface and super resolution imagery (2 meters/pixel) of selected areas. It will also produce a map of the mineral composition of the surface at 100 meter resolution, map the composition of the atmosphere and determine its global circulation, determine the structure of the sub-surface to a depth of a few kilometers, determine the effect of the atmosphere on the planetary surface, and determine how the atmosphere interacts with the solar wind. Mars Express spends a portion of its orbit facing Mars to collect data, and the other part facing the Earth to transmit data back to ground stations. Every day, the ground stations receive between 0.5 and 5 Gbits of scientific data from Mars Express.

The main objective of the MRO mission is to investigate the presence of water on Mars. Other Mars missions have shown that water existed on Mars’ surface in the past, but scientists still don’t know whether water was around long enough to foster development of life. MRO is taking close-up photographs of the Martian surface, analyzing minerals, searching for subsurface water, measuring the dust and water content of the atmosphere, and monitoring daily weather conditions.

ERDAS Releases ECW for ArcGIS Server

ERDAS proudly announces the introduction of the all-new ECW for ArcGIS Server, which provides a means for ArcGIS Server 10 to deliver Enhanced Compression Wavelet (ECW) data to clients via OGC-compliant Web Coverage Service (WCS) and Web Map Service (WMS).

Using components of the ERDAS ECW/JP2 SDK version 4.2, ECW for ArcGIS Server enables ArcGIS Server to support ECW imagery, providing the fastest decompression available. Using minimal memory, ECW can quickly decompress and open massive files, in many cases faster than uncompressed imagery can be opened. Additionally, multi-resolution level of detail is built into the file, eliminating the need to generate or distribute pyramids or overviews. The ECW technique does not require that immediate tiles (RRDs) be calculated and stored on disk; they are an inherent part of ECW’s Discrete Wavelet Transformations (DWT). ECW also supports opacity channels, allowing images to overlay other imagery cleanly without showing compression artifacts around the edges.

The ERDAS ECW/JP2 SDK technology was developed by ER Mapper Ltd beginning in 1998 and is governed by three patents (US6201897, US6442298, and US6633688).

ECW for ArcGIS Server may be installed on a single ArcGIS Server, with or without other ERDAS software installed. However, ECW for ArcGIS Server does require a FlexNet license file from ERDAS.

This new product expands the industry-wide level of support for the ECW format. ECW is already supported in traditional desktop GIS, CAD and remote sensing packages such as ArcGIS, AutoCAD, ERDAS IMAGINE, ERDAS ER Mapper, FalconView, Bentley Microstation, ENVI and PCI Geomatica.

Download LPS 2011 on ERDAS Website

ERDAS proudly announces the official release of LPS 2011, now available for download on the ERDAS website.

LPS is a powerful, workflow-oriented photogrammetry system for production mapping, including full analytical triangulation, the generation of digital terrain models, orthophoto production, mosaicking, and 3D feature extraction.

It supports panchromatic, color and multispectral imagery with up to 16 bits per band and hundreds of different coordinate systems and map projections. LPS increases accuracy through state-of-the-art photogrammetric and image processing algorithms for automatic point measurement, triangulation, automatic terrain extraction and subpixel point positioning. Accuracy reports, built-in data quality checks, and editing tools make it easy to maintain unwavering levels of quality.

A key theme for LPS 2011 is the optimization of productivity and efficiency. Many of these gains are accomplished through distributed processing, which enables users to leverage multi-core CPUs and multiple networked servers to increase production throughput and accelerate processes like ortho generation. LPS 2011 combines its existing batch processing capabilities with Condor (third-party software available for free download) to harness the power of several networked computers for high throughput ortho generation.

LPS eATE is an add-on module for LPS that derives dense point clouds from stereo imagery. For this release, LPS eATE adds the ability to distribute the Digital Terrain Model (DTM) merging process to the existing ability to distribute terrain extraction, further reducing overall processing time.

LPS 2011 also provides gains in efficiency. Users can now generate orthophotos for an area of interest defined by a shapefile or AOI, excluding unnecessary pixels from processing and reducing the time and resources required for the ortho production process. Additionally, the Stereo Point Measurement (SPM) Tool now supports the use of multiple orthophotos (base maps) as a horizontal reference source of ground control points. Orthophotos are conveniently shown in the image list based on the degree of overlap with the master image and users can easily identify reference points in stereo and mono modes.

ERDAS ADE 2010 Released

ERDAS released ERDAS ADE 2010. It is an integrated suite of products for real-time editing of spatial and business data via the web, desktop or mobile device. Integrated with the Oracle technology stack, this suite of products includes ERDAS ADE Remote, ERDAS ADE Mobile and ERDAS ADE Enterprise.

“ERDAS ADE is an enterprise-enabled solution providing geospatial access and accurate data capture in a web, desktop or mobile application,” said Mladen Stojic, Senior Vice President, Product Management and Marketing, ERDAS. “With an improved workflow, ERDAS ADE 2010 efficiently handles data and gives users control of database updates,” continued Stojic.

ERDAS ADE Remote provides rich, secure and flexible spatial and operational management for field force operations that require the capture and maintenance of location and business data. Users can manage data locally (files on disk), connect directly to Oracle, or connect to ERDAS ADE Enterprise.

Providing connected and disconnected users with a common software platform, ERDAS ADE Mobile offers versatility and flexibility for data collection and validation requirements. ERDAS ADE Mobile is a powerful spatial editor for any Windows Mobile GPS or hand-held device.

ERDAS ADE Enterprise provides the ability to scale in a web based environment as well as real-time spatial data editing. Leveraging the complete Oracle technology stack, ERDAS ADE Enterprise supports editing of all Oracle data types, including spatial, topology features, topology primitives and attribute data.

In ERDAS ADE 2010, there is now WMS (Web Mapping Service) support, as well as new viewer manipulation tools to swipe all rasters or vectors in the view to see underlying data. The offline file storage system has been improved to allow more data to be taken into the field. Support for targeted updates and improved conflict resolution tools give users greater control, should problems arise from multiple users editing the same data. This release also introduces a new implementation of the ERDAS ADE Mobile product with better memory management, performance, user experience and the ability to edit Shapefiles.

ERDAS LPS 2010 - Photogrammetry System Released

ERDAS released LPS 2010. LPS Core now includes ERDAS MosaicPro (as well as IMAGINE Advantage). In addition, this release provides improved sensor support and increased performance. LPS is a powerful softcopy photogrammetry system for a variety of workflows, defence, remote-area mapping, transportation planning, orthophoto production and close-range applications. With automated algorithms, fast processing and a tight focus on workflow, LPS ensures productivity.

By adding ERDAS MosaicPro to LPS 2010, customers will have decreased memory use and greater processing speed, making it easier to mosaic a large number of images. As part of the streamlining of mosaicking across the product lines, it includes the merged functionality of the IMAGINE Mosaic Tool. In addition, there is a new illumination equalisation colour balancing method.

LPS 2010 is compatible in data processing from a wide variety of sensors. It is compatible for GeoEye and WorldView rigorous models from multiple formats, including NCDRD. There is the support for KOMPSAT RPC and RapidEye NITF RPC as well.

Other performance improvements include accelerated vertical datum handling when using large DEMs in ortho-resampling and calibration, as well as better memory handling in the Terrain Prep tool. The Terrain Editor has received several productivity enhancing interface changes. ERDAS has also added grid correction for modelling focal plane distortions in ORIMA. The computed grid can be imported to LPS.
